On Saturday, September 16 the focus turns to bats.
A regional bat expert will be guiding visitors around Coronation Park, Ormskirk, discussing the different habitats in the park and how they are valuable to our local bat populations. The free bat walk will start at 7.15pm and booking is required.
For walkers seeking a longer route, the Skelmersdale circular walk on Sunday, September 17 is for you.
Meeting at 10am at Skelmersdale Library, the seven-mile walk will highlight just how beautiful and green some areas of Skelmersdale are.
The walk is free and booking is not required.
